Here at Penpont Farm, we have a flock of 750 sheep that lamb in two parts. Our winter lambs start at the begining of November and continue through until a week before Christmas. The second flock lamb in March and April. Once we start, there will be a constant stream of baby lambs being born both day and night.
Our new bird hide overlooks our wetlands/marshes and is just at the end of Walsmley Bird Sanctuary, which is nationally important for wintering waders and wildfowl.
